This is bad if you're using -snapshot and want to have a clean virtual disk-image after guest-shutdown. You have no possibility to commit because qemu just quits and the /tmp/snapshot-File is not accessible anymore. $ qemu --help | grep no-quit -no-quit disable SDL window close capability This option works perfectly, there is no bug. What you want is -no-shutdown. -- Aurelien Jarno GPG: 1024D/F1BCDB73 aurelien@aurel32.net http://www.aurel32.net
